Volunteer at Oracle State Park

Corrine Glesne Only 12 miles from SaddleBrooke Ranch, Oracle State Park is a 4,000-acre wildlife refuge in the foothills of the Catalinas. It has more than 15 miles of trails, including a section of the Arizona Trail.
